WebNov 3, 2024 · As a beginner, achieving 2-3 sets per muscle group per workout or 8-10 sets per muscle per week can easily be done with just 3 full-body workouts per week. But then, as a more experienced lifter, fitting 8-10 sets per muscle per workout or 16-20 sets per muscle per week into just 3 full-body workouts becomes a challenge.
